javascript - 使用 javascript 从 Bootstrap 3 自动创建输入组

标签 javascript css twitter-bootstrap

我正在尝试使用 javascript 自动修改我的输入框

<div class="input-group">
**<input type="text" class="form-control " placeholder="Text input">**
<span class="input-group-addon">*</span>
</div>

jsfiddle:http://jsfiddle.net/BEC7N/

粗体 行是已经存在的行。

下面是我的javascript尝试

$('[data-val-required]').prepend(' <div class="input-group">');
$('[data-val-required]').append(' <span class="input-group-addon">*</span></div>');

但它不起作用。有任何想法吗?谢谢。

最佳答案

将您的代码更改为:

$('[data-val-required]').wrap(' <div class="input-group"></div>');
$('[data-val-required]').after(' <span class="input-group-addon">*</span>');
$('[data-val-required]').after(' <span class="required-indicator">*</span>');

Working Example

关于javascript - 使用 javascript 从 Bootstrap 3 自动创建输入组,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27281387/

相关文章:

javascript - 包装 `console.log` 并保留调用堆栈

css - 标题不断移入导航栏(Bootstrap)

jquery - 如何在单页应用程序 [Bootstrap] 上更改导航栏的事件颜色

css - 在 Bootstrap 选择上应用样式

javascript - 我怎样才能使文本仅在其他文本淡出后才重复淡入?

javascript - jqgrid创建后如何应用列模板

css - 如何保持img :hover within the page boundaries?

css - 使用相对路径时,gulp-sass 导入不会重新设置正确图像的 url

html - 将 h4 标签与叠加颜色上的按钮对齐

javascript - 解决最小化关键请求深度 - 页面性能